πŸ’‘ About the IDR Team

The Integrations, Detection & Response (IDR) team plays a critical role in Arctic Wolf’s cybersecurity ecosystem.

The team works on:

  • Integrating third-party detection and response products
  • Building and maintaining high-quality security detections
  • Resolving integration-related maintenance requests and bugs
  • Investigating breach failure-to-detect (BFD) events
  • Enhancing detection accuracy and system reliability

This team operates at the intersection of:

  • Software engineering
  • Security operations
  • Detection engineering
  • Platform integration

It’s an ideal environment for engineers who enjoy both coding and cybersecurity problem-solving.
